Transportation from the City Center to Sofia Airport
Known as one of the most impressive countries of the Balkans, Bulgaria's most developed region in terms of culture and trade, the capital Sofia, is one of the most frequently used flight routes by travel enthusiasts. There are flights to Sofia Airport, the largest international airport in Bulgaria, from many parts of the world. The fact that the airport is approximately 10 kilometers from the city center minimizes the transportation stress experienced after the journey.
There are many alternatives to reach Sofia Airport, which is 10 km from the city center. It is possible to reach the airport by using bus, metro, taxi and car rental options.
Metro services in the city, which start at 5.30 in the morning, continue until midnight. It takes about 18 minutes to reach the airport from the city center by metro. 84 Sofia Airport-Gen. Gurko Street and 384 Sofia Airport-Druzhba 2 bus lines are among the alternatives that can be used to reach the airport from the city center.
Another public transportation method that provides transportation from the city center to the airport is the metro. You can reach the airport terminal by metro, which is an economical and fast method.
You can reach the airport quickly and comfortably by using the taxis available all over the city.
In Sofia, which is a bicycle-friendly city, you can reach the airport from the city center by using bicycles as well as transportation vehicles such as taxis and buses. There are also parking spots in the area where cars and bicycles can be parked. If you do not have your own private vehicle and will use a taxi, be sure to negotiate the price with the driver. In addition, many hotels provide free shuttle services to their customers who will go to and from the airport.

Transportation from Van Ferit Melen Airport to City Center
Van Ferit Melen Airport, that has international connections since the year 2009, is an airport located in easternmost point of Turkey. The nearest airport is the Hoy Airport located in Iran and the airport is the first among others in Turkey that satellite landing system had been established. Ferit Melen Airport that is among first airports in Turkey built with unmilitary status has direct flight connections that are operated regularly from/to Ankara and Istanbul and indirect connections with other cities through Turkish Airlines, Atlas Jet and Pegasus Airlines.
Transportation from Ferit Melen Airport to the city center of Van which is 8 km away is provided through services of taxis, busses, mini buses, shuttle buses of Turkish Airlines and Anadolu Jet.
For passengers who consider reaching to Van from the airport through taxi, might have 10 or 15 minutes long journey with a taxi that might be taken in front of domestic and international terminals of the airport.
For the passengers who would like to go to the city center through public bus services, might again use bus services once in every 20-30 minutes in front of the security gate of the airport, 300 meters away from the terminal building of the airport. Additionally, there are mini busses going to city center that are going through the airport intersection, 900 meters away from the terminal building. As another option, through mini busses services operating regularly on hourly basis, the city center, bus station, marina, train station or other destinations can be reached directly or indirectly.
For the passengers of Turkish Airline and Anadolu Jet, there are shuttle services between the airport and Erciş, Şemdinli and Yüksekova.
